     Wedding Dress for 3rd Marriage  

Hi,

I am having a small wedding with family and friends (not more than 50) and my fiancee says I can't wear a wedding dress. He said that I have to wear a regular dress or suit. I am 58 and have been married 2 times. I never had a nice wedding. I picked out a very nice wedding dress and he said I shouldn't wear it because it would upset his parents. Is this true? Now I don't know what to wear.

Dear Peggy,

No, this is not true. You may wear any attire that fits the formality of your event. The only exception is the blusher veil. It is reserved for first time brides.

I agree, but you'll want to select a dress that is age appropriate and coordinates with the formality of your wedding. Many wedding dresses are designed with the 20 -36 aged woman in mind (think cinderella ball gown!) so try on lots of dresses to see which suit you.
